What is a zero-day exploit?
A. It is when a new network vulnerability is discovered before a fix is available
B. It is when the perpetrator inserts itself in a conversation between two parties and captures or alters data.
C. It is when the network is saturated with malicious traffic that overloads resources and bandwidth
D. It is when an attacker inserts malicious code into a SOL server.
